Visual Studio Code(vsCode) 下 C/C++ 环境搭建

1,715 阅读1分钟

本文教程参考官方文档:code.visualstudio.com/docs/cpp/co…

安装 Visual Studio Code

Visual Studio Code 下载地址:code.visualstudio.com/download

安装插件:C/C++ extension for VS Code

安装插件:Code Runner

安装 Mingw-w64

MinGW-w64 下载地址:sourceforge.net/projects/mi…

可以下载在线安装器:MinGW-W64-install.exe,笔者下载的是完整版,省得在线安装缓慢。

下载好的安装包名为:x86_64-8.1.0-release-win32-seh-rt_v6-rev0.7z,使用 7-Zip 解压缩工具解压该安装包。进入解压后的文件目录,里面 mingw64 文件目录,将其剪切到指定的不含空格及中文目录下。

配置系统环境变量:Mingw-w64

将创建好的环境变量配置到 Path 中:

配置好 Mingw-w64 系统环境变量之后,打开 cmd 或者 windows terminal 终端窗口,执行如下命令可可以查看 gcc/g++ 编译器版本:

gcc -v
# 或者执行
g++ -v

出现版本信息则表示 Mingw-w64 安装成功:

Visual Studio Code 常用设置

Visual Studio Code 设置自动保存

在设置中,找到文件,设置失去焦点自动保存:

Code Runner 插件配置

防止运行 code runner 插件时,出现:vscode 中出现无法在只读编辑器中编辑问题,设置如下:

运行 C 文件

步骤1:使用 vsCode 创建一个 c 文件:

#include <stdio.h>

int main() {
    printf("woodwhales.cn");
    return 0;
}

步骤2:创建配置任务文件:在 "终端" 菜单中选择 "配置任务"

点击 "C/C++",vsCode 自动生成配置文件:

步骤3:执行 C 文件:

也可以点击按钮执行:

步骤5:生成可执行文件:ctrl + shift + B

个人博客:woodwhale's blog

博客园:木鲸鱼的博客